Here's another weird one relating to reports.
I created a report using fields from two seperate tables.
MasterAccounts and SubAccounts
All they do is display login ID as well as creation date and start date =
filtered by Region and the referred by fields in MasterAccounts. Now =
all works well until I try to incorporate the payments table and show =
the amounts of any payments the user has made. As soon as I add in the =
new field for amount, the database doesnt give me any records. It's not =
the smart linking problem because all I have linked is the Customer ID =
field which is common to all three tables. This is annoying because I =
need to get it to show me the subtotals of all the payments for the =
users in that region and then give me a grand total to date. Im using =
crystal reports 4.5 so I dont know if that could have anything to do =
with it. CR 4.5 seems a bit lame sometimes. Any help appreciated.
